Transaction 5631c603da5288bc3414ecf761272f06fa5d7607bad16f5510993c22fa9e83a1
1 Input
1 Output
-
5631c603da5288bc3414ecf761272f06fa5d7607bad16f5510993c22fa9e83a1:0
- value
- 1147268
- script pubkey
- OP_0 OP_PUSHBYTES_20 3cfdb0555a72497d05b0a9989a012bf78fcd384e
- address
- bc1q8n7mq426wfyh6pds4xvf5qft778u6wzwj36f2k